Creating an Assignment


To create an Assignment in Canvas, you'll follow similar steps to creating a Discussion. Check out the written or video instructions below for creating an Assignment:

Written Instructions

  1. Select the "+" plus sign to the right of the Module title.
  2. From the dropdown menu, select "Assignment."
  3. Select "[New Assignment]."
  4. Type the Assignment title in the Assignment Name box.
  5. Select "Add Item"
  6. Click on the Assignment title.
  7. Select "Edit" at the top of the page. 
  8. Type instructions for students in the text box. If you need to attach any documents, attach to the text box the same way you would to a Page. 
  9. Type points possible in the Points box. The default Assignment Group will be Assignments. If you select the dropdown, you can add other assignment group titles if you wish.
  10. For Submission Type select "Online."
  11. Check the box for "File Uploads." This option allows students to submit documents. 
    1. If you'd like to use Turnitin as a plagiarism checker, select the dropdown next to Plagiarism Review and then select Turnitin.
  12. Down below, add a Due Date and Available From / Until dates if applicable. (These are open and close dates for the assignment.)
  13. Select "Save & Publish" to post to students. (Reminder: If you select Save only, students won't be able to see the discussion.)
